Like many world-beating cities, London is fuelled by coffee. Although the capital was an early adopter of the brew back in the 1600s, tea reigned supreme for several centuries. The arrival of ...
For many of us, one of the best parts about traveling is kicking back in a beautiful coffee shop and savoring a tasty beverage while watching the world go by. There’s just something so cozy and ...
The Infatuation on MSN
The 22 best coffee shops in London
As anyone who has ever stopped at a service station at 1am can confirm, not all coffee is created equal. We’ve put this guide ...
Some results have been hidden because they may be inaccessible to you
Show inaccessible results